For a typical home or small business owner, replacing a heating or cooling system is an infrequent event. Learning about the latest technology and getting quotes from multiple installers can be very time consuming and confusing. A volunteer coach can help a homeowner get informed and become more confident that they’re choosing the installer and equipment that best meets their needs and budget, and reduces their carbon footprint.

Coaching can be done at different levels, from basic to advanced. At the basic level, coaches explain the motivation for converting to heat pumps and the types of systems available, how to get an energy audits and how to identify suitable installers. At the advanced level, coaches may analyze past energy use to assess a home’s efficiency and heating requirements and help the homeowner evaluate proposals.  Volunteer coaching can be done at a pace and time commitment that suits your schedule, from an occasional effort to a full-time retirement gig.
